What companies run services between Orpington, England and Earl's Court, England?

Stagecoach London operates a bus from High Street /Orpington War Memorial to Trafalgar Square/Charing Cross hourly.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 1h 19m. Alternatively, Southeastern operates a train from Orpington to London Victoria every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£7–15 and the journey takes 43 min. Thameslink also services this route twice a week.
